Manchester Metropolitan University seeks a Student Experience and Transformation Manager to lead strategic projects that enhance the student journey. You will drive engagement, transition and belonging, turning insights into practicable improvements across Student Services.
The role requires influential leadership, strong PM skills and a deep understanding of the higher education context, with a commitment to inclusive practice and positive outcomes for all students.

As Student Experience and Transformation Manager, you'll play a pivotal role in driving strategic change across Student Services, helping to ensure that all interactions students have with us are connected, accessible and impactful.
As part of the Student Services Leadership Team, you'll play a leading role in shaping and enhancing the student experience across Manchester Met. Working collaboratively with colleagues across Academic and Professional Services, you'll turn insight into action, ensuring our services support students effectively from application through to graduation.
This is a highly visible role that offers the opportunity to influence institutional priorities, work closely with senior stakeholders and lead initiatives that make a lasting difference to the student experience across the University.
